A nice, low-key, subtle comedy-drama
26 August 1999
This film is an interesting character study of an inhibited, uptight single mother, her wild sister, and her rebellious, coming-of-age daughter. It didn't earn a higher rating than 7 because some of the scenes and dialogues are cliches, but it's definitely worth a watch for its unconventional African-American middle-class setting. One of the themes is that mothers can learn as much from their daughters as vice versa.
